About The Role:

As a CBRE Sr Cybersecurity Engineer, you will support and secure global enterprise scale Active Directory (AD), Entra ID (Azure AD), and their underlying components in a hybrid environment. You will play a key role in authentication, automation, and monitoring, ensuring the integrity and availability of directory services for our organization.

This job is part of the Cybersecurity job function. They are responsible for identifying security risks and developing procedures to prevent future incidents.

What You'll Do:

  • Architect, implement, and maintain secure directory systems, including AD and Entra ID environments (on-premises and cloud).
  • Serve as a subject matter expert for authentication and directory facilitated authorization.
  • Investigate and resolve security vulnerabilities related to directory system components.
  • Lead and contribute to global projects enabling and supporting directory services.
  • Develop and maintain automated solutions for monitoring and managing directory service components at scale.
  • Provide L3 support for critical directory service components, including troubleshooting and resolving complex authentication and directory issues.
  • Collaborate with a globally distributed team, with members located in different regions.
  • Manage and provide guidance related to permissions, group policies, and access controls for AD and Entra ID.
  • Collaborate with IT and security teams to ensure compliance and best practices.
  • Document processes, configurations, and incident responses.

What You'll Need:

To perform this job successfully, an individual will need to perform each crucial du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form essential functions.

  • Bachelor's Degree preferred with 8-10 years of relevant experience with 3+ years supporting 3+ year supporting enterprise or government-level directory services (AD, Entra ID/Azure AD). In lieu of a degree, a combination of experience and education will be considered.
  • In depth understanding of AD and Entra ID architecture, permissions, and security best practices.
  • Expertise with Active Directory, Entra ID, Azure, AWS, GCP, DNS, Entra Conditional Access, Entra Connect, and Federation.
  • Strong scripting and automation skills (PowerShell, Python, or similar).
  • Expertise in authentication protocols (Kerberos, SAML, OAuth, etc.).
  • Experience with monitoring tools and SIEM platforms.
  • Excellent troubleshooting, communication, and documentation skills.
  • Relevant certifications (preferred): Microsoft Certified, CISSP, etc.
